The Musician

edit

Phil Christensen is a composer living in New York City who works in a wide variety of styles, including funk, blues, jazz, fusion, rock, avant garde, electronic, progressive rock, and many others. His influences are an equally large number of musicians, including (but not limited to) Frank Zappa, Trey Anastasio, Miles Davis, John Scofield, John Medeski, and Jaco Pastorius.

Phil has recently completed his Master's degree in Studio Composition at SUNY Purchase, where he studied with the avant garde composer Joel Thome. In the winter of 2006 Phil wrote the score for an off-off Broadway play called InsideOut, created by Live Project. Tracks from this show are available on Phil Christensen Music.

Prior to this, Phil earned a bachelor's in music from SUNY Oswego where he studied under Dr. Anthony Crain, and Dr. Julie Pretzat. A member of the Solid State jazz ensemble under the direction of Stan Gosek, Phil also directed the department jazz lab band, teaching newer players jazz standards and improvisational techniques. During this time he also studied with guitarist Carmen Caramanica in New Hartford, NY.

The Programmer

edit

Phil is the author of several open source projects, including modu, a web toolkit for Python, txOpenID, a Twisted-powered OpenID provider, txspace, a web-enabled MUD-like system for creating online games, and the Jam2 Drupal module, a tool for helping independent musicians manage their music online.

Other areas of expertise include application development, distributed computing, computational linguistics and networking.
